Congress comments on Anna unfortunate, says BJP

The Bharatiya Janata Party Sunday said the Congress party's allegations of corruption against Anna Hazare were "unfortunate".

Talking to reporters, BJP President Nitin Gadkari sought Prime Minister Manmohan Singh's intervention in the matter.

“It is unfortunate,” Gadkari said.

“It is Prime Minister's responsibility to protect democracy in the country. If the people under him are behaving undemocratically, will the prime minister not pay attention to it?” he said.

Congress spokesperson Manish Tewari Sunday alleged that anti-graft campaigner Anna Hazare is himself involved in corruption, adding that people linked to the veteran Gandhian are facing serious charges of corruption, including extortion, land grabbing and blackmailing.
